The specific hardware structure of each access network equipment are as follows:
Node server:
As shown in Fig. 2, mainly including Network Interface Module 201, switching engine module 202, CPU module 203, disk array
Module 204;
Wherein, Network Interface Module 201, the Bao Jun that CPU module 203, disk array module 204 are come in enter switching engine
Module 202;Switching engine module 202 look into the operation of address table 205 to the packet come in, to obtain the navigation information of packet;
And the packet is stored according to the navigation information of packet the queue of corresponding pack buffer 206;If the queue of pack buffer 206 is close
It is full, then it abandons;All pack buffer queues of 202 poll of switching engine mould, are forwarded: 1) port if meeting the following conditions
It is less than to send caching;2) the queue package counting facility is greater than zero.Disk array module 204 mainly realizes the control to hard disk, including
The operation such as initialization, read-write to hard disk;CPU module 203 is mainly responsible between access switch, terminal (not shown)
Protocol processes, to address table 205 (including descending protocol packet address table, uplink protocol package address table, data packet addressed table)
Configuration, and, the configuration to disk array module 204.
Access switch:
As shown in figure 3, mainly including Network Interface Module (downstream network interface module 301, uplink network interface module
302), switching engine module 303 and CPU module 304;
Wherein, the packet (upstream data) that downstream network interface module 301 is come in enters packet detection module 305;Packet detection mould
Whether mesh way address (DA), source address (SA), type of data packet and the packet length of the detection packet of block 305 meet the requirements, if met,
It then distributes corresponding flow identifier (stream-id), and enters switching engine module 303, otherwise abandon;Uplink network interface mould
The packet (downlink data) that block 302 is come in enters switching engine module 303;The data packet that CPU module 204 is come in enters switching engine
Module 303;Switching engine module 303 look into the operation of address table 306 to the packet come in, to obtain the navigation information of packet;
If the packet into switching engine module 303 is that downstream network interface is gone toward uplink network interface, in conjunction with flow identifier
(stream-id) packet is stored in the queue of corresponding pack buffer 307;If the queue of the pack buffer 307 is close full,
It abandons;If the packet into switching engine module 303 is not that downstream network interface is gone toward uplink network interface, according to packet
Navigation information is stored in the data packet queue of corresponding pack buffer 307;If the queue of the pack buffer 307 is close full,
Then abandon.
All pack buffer queues of 303 poll of switching engine module, are divided to two kinds of situations in embodiments of the present invention:
If the queue is that downstream network interface is gone toward uplink network interface, meets the following conditions and be forwarded: 1)
It is less than that the port sends caching;2) the queue package counting facility is greater than zero;3) token that rate control module generates is obtained;
If the queue is not that downstream network interface is gone toward uplink network interface, meets the following conditions and is forwarded:
1) it is less than to send caching for the port;2) the queue package counting facility is greater than zero.
Rate control module 308 is configured by CPU module 304, to all downlink networks in programmable interval
Interface generates token toward the pack buffer queue that uplink network interface is gone, to control the code rate of forwarded upstream.
CPU module 304 is mainly responsible for the protocol processes between node server, the configuration to address table 306, and,
Configuration to rate control module 308.
Ethernet association turns gateway:
As shown in figure 4, mainly including Network Interface Module (downstream network interface module 401, uplink network interface module
402), switching engine module 403, CPU module 404, packet detection module 405, rate control module 408, address table 406, Bao Huan
Storage 407 and MAC adding module 409, MAC removing module 410.
Wherein, the data packet that downstream network interface module 401 is come in enters packet detection module 405;Packet detection module 405 is examined
Ethernet mac DA, ethernet mac SA, Ethernet length or frame type, the view networking mesh way address of measured data packet
DA, whether meet the requirements depending on networking source address SA, depending on networking data Packet type and packet length, corresponding stream is distributed if meeting
Identifier (stream-id);Then, MAC DA, MAC SA, length or frame type are subtracted by MAC removing module 410
(2byte), and enter corresponding receive and cache, otherwise abandon;
Downstream network interface module 401 detects the transmission caching of the port, according to the view of packet networking mesh if there is Bao Ze
Address D A knows the ethernet mac DA of corresponding terminal, adds the ethernet mac DA of terminal, Ethernet assists the MAC for turning gateway
SA, Ethernet length or frame type, and send.
The function that Ethernet association turns other modules in gateway is similar with access switch.
Terminal:
It mainly include Network Interface Module, Service Processing Module and CPU module;For example, set-top box mainly connects including network
Mouth mold block, video/audio encoding and decoding engine modules, CPU module;Encoding board mainly includes Network Interface Module, video encoding engine
Module, CPU module;Memory mainly includes Network Interface Module, CPU module and disk array module.

2, networking data package definition is regarded
2.1 access network data package definitions
Access net data packet mainly include following sections: destination address (DA), source address (SA), reserve bytes,
payload(PDU)、CRC。
As shown in the table, the data packet for accessing net mainly includes following sections:
DA | SA | Reserved | Payload | CRC |
Wherein:
Destination address (DA) is made of 8 bytes (byte), and first character section indicates type (such as the various associations of data packet
Discuss packet, multicast packet, unicast packet etc.), be up to 256 kinds of possibility, the second byte to the 6th byte is metropolitan area net address,
Seven, the 8th bytes are access net address;
Source address (SA) is also to be made of 8 bytes (byte), is defined identical as destination address (DA);
Reserve bytes are made of 2 bytes;
The part payload has different length according to the type of different datagrams, is if it is various protocol packages
64 bytes are 32+1024=1056 bytes if it is single group unicast packets words, are not restricted to above 2 kinds certainly;
CRC is made of 4 bytes, and calculation method follows the Ethernet CRC algorithm of standard.
2.2 Metropolitan Area Network (MAN) packet definitions
The topology of Metropolitan Area Network (MAN) is pattern, may there is 2 kinds, connection even of more than two kinds, i.e. node switching between two equipment
It can all can exceed that 2 kinds between machine and node server, node switch and node switch, node switch and node server
Connection.But the metropolitan area net address of metropolitan area network equipment is uniquely, to close to accurately describe the connection between metropolitan area network equipment
System, introduces parameter in embodiments of the present invention: label, uniquely to describe a metropolitan area network equipment.
(Multi-Protocol Label Switch, multiprotocol label are handed over by the definition of label and MPLS in this specification
Change) label definition it is similar, it is assumed that between equipment A and equipment B there are two connection, then data packet from equipment A to equipment B just
There are 2 labels, data packet also there are 2 labels from equipment B to equipment A.Label is divided into label, outgoing label, it is assumed that data packet enters
The label (entering label) of equipment A is 0x0000, and the label (outgoing label) when this data packet leaves equipment A may reform into
0x0001.The networking process of Metropolitan Area Network (MAN) is to enter network process under centralized control, also means that address distribution, the label of Metropolitan Area Network (MAN)
Distribution be all to be dominated by metropolitan area server, node switch, node server be all passively execute, this point with
The label distribution of MPLS is different, and the distribution of the label of MPLS is the result that interchanger, server are negotiated mutually.
As shown in the table, the data packet of Metropolitan Area Network (MAN) mainly includes following sections:
DA | SA | Reserved | Label | Payload | CRC |
That is destination address (DA), source address (SA), reserve bytes (Reserved), label, payload (PDU), CRC.Its
In, the format of label, which can refer to, such as gives a definition: label is 32bit, wherein high 16bit retains, only with low 16bit, its position
Set is between the reserve bytes and payload of data packet.

It is a kind of architecture diagram of monitoring control system provided in an embodiment of the present invention, monitoring control system referring to Fig. 5, Fig. 5
System turns server 503 and monitor terminal 504 including terminal 501, streaming media server 502, association, wherein terminal 501 can be intelligence
Energy terminal such as smart phone, tablet computer, notebook etc., monitor terminal 504 can be cradle head camera, and cradle head camera is
It supports rotation up and down and changes the camera of the functions such as focal length.Terminal 501 sends control letter to streaming media server 502
Breath, control information include information type and the information content corresponding with information type, and media server 502 receives terminal 501 and sends out
The control information sent, streaming media server 502 control the information type that information includes and corresponding with information type based on the received
The information content generate control instruction, 502 Xiang Xiezhuan server 503 of streaming media server send control instruction, association turn server
503 send control instruction to monitor terminal 504, and monitor terminal 504 receives control instruction and according to control instruction to monitor terminal
504 monitored picture is adjusted.
Wherein, information type includes carrying out mobile mobile type, for changing for the monitoring angle to monitor terminal 504
Become the zoom for changing focus type and zoom is carried out for the monitored picture to monitor terminal 504 of the focal length of monitor terminal 504
At least one of type.For example, if information type be mobile type, the information content corresponding with mobile type can for for
The identification information moved up to the monitoring angle of monitor terminal 504 with identification information 0 (for example, identified to monitor terminal
504 monitoring angle is moved up), or the mark moved down for the monitoring angle to monitor terminal 504
Information (for example, the monitoring angle of monitor terminal 504 is moved down with the mark of identification information 1), or for monitoring
The identification information that the monitoring angle of terminal 504 is moved to the left is (for example, with the mark of identification information 2 to the prison of monitor terminal 504
Control angle is moved to the left), or the identification information (example to move right for the monitoring angle to monitor terminal 504
Such as, it is moved right with the mark of identification information 3 to the monitoring angle of monitor terminal 504).Streaming media server 502 is according to connecing
The mobile type of receipts and the information content corresponding with mobile type generate control instruction, to receive control in monitor terminal 504
Angle can be monitored to monitor terminal 504 according to control instruction when system instruction to be moved up or moved down, Huo Zhexiang
It moves left, or moves right, the monitored picture of monitor terminal 504 is adjusted to realize.
For example, if information type is to change focus type, with change the corresponding information content of focus type can for for
The identification information to further to the monitored picture of monitor terminal 504 with identification information 0 (for example, identified to monitor terminal 504
Monitored picture further), or zoomed out for the monitored picture to monitor terminal 504 identification information (for example, with
Identification information 1 zooms out the monitored picture of monitor terminal 504 to identify).Streaming media server 502 changes based on the received
Focus type and the information content corresponding with focus type is changed generate control instruction, to receive control in monitor terminal 504
504 focal length of monitor terminal can be changed according to control instruction when system instruction, the monitored picture of monitor terminal 504 is made to further or draw
Far, the monitored picture of monitor terminal 504 is adjusted to realize.
If information type is zoom type, the information content corresponding with zoom type can be for for monitor terminal 504
The monitored picture identification information that zooms in or out, such as with identification information+identify the monitoring to monitor terminal 504
Picture, which is put, to be twice, with identification information ++ to identify 2 times of the monitored picture amplification to monitor terminal 504, marked with identification information-
Know and the monitored picture of monitor terminal 504 is reduced 1 times, with identification information -- the monitored picture of monitor terminal 504 is reduced 2 times.
Zoom type and the information content corresponding with zoom type generate control instruction to streaming media server 502 based on the received, thus
It can be amplified according to monitored picture of the control instruction to monitor terminal 504 when monitor terminal 504 receives control instruction
Or reduce, the monitored picture of monitor terminal 504 is adjusted to realize.
